Grandma Moses competition opens

Gosford Council has opened entries to the Grandma Moses Exhibition, which last year included several winners from the Peninsula area.

"Hopefully we will attract more entrants from the Peninsula this year," council senior citizen centre coordinator Ms Rhondda Gibson said.

"The forms are available from Ettalong Senior Citizens Centre, Woy Woy and Umina Library and the Peninsula Community Centre.

"All enquiries can be made on 4324 4749.

"The competition is open to all artists 50 years and over."

The competition has five sections.

Section one is the open competition, which can be done in any medium, and has a prize of $750.

Section two is the watercolour competition and has a prize of $550.

Section three is the novice competition for new painters and has a prize of $300.

Section four is for the Senior Citizens' Centre art group member, with a prize of $300.

Section five is open, in any medium, for Central Coast inspired work.

The prize is $300.

The paintings will be exhibited at Gosford Senior Citizens' Centre from 10.30am to 4pm on Tuesday, September 11, Wednesday, September 12 and Thursday, September 13.

Prize winners will be announced at the Gosford Senior Citizens' Centre on Tuesday, September 11 at 10.30am.

The entry fee per painting is $2.50.
